Greece offers almost every attraction under the sun. Its capital, Athens, has treasures and pleasures everywhere, from its temple-topped Acropolis and Roman Agora to museums, tavernas, and markets. Guides will show you the must-sees and share their backstories to save you hassle and homework. Other options include foodie delves into Greek cuisine, lazy-day Saronic island cruises, and trips to Cape Sounion, Meteora, and classical Delphi. But Greece tours aren’t just about Athens and the mainland. Greece’s 227 inhabited islands, including gorgeous Santorini and Mykonos, are constant siren calls—offering bliss-inducing catamaran cruises and excursions around sugar-cube villages, wineries, monasteries, and beaches.
